ABSTRACT:
An improved tow bar assembly and attaching system for use of heavy vehicles eighing in excess of 50 tons. The invention reduces shock to the two bar assembly though a hook and loop attaching means between the tow bar and the towed vehicle. Reinforcing composite windings about the midpoint of the tow bar reduce the overall weight of the tow bar while increasing strength and rigidity in critical areas.
